Ascent conjecture for Schröder paths and 021-avoiding inversion sequences
Ascent conjecture for Schröder paths and 021-avoiding inversion sequences
Let denote the Schröder paths of length , and let an ascent be a maximal sequence of consecutive up steps in a Schröder path. Let denote the inversion sequences of length avoiding the pattern .
Ascent conjecture. The number of Schröder paths with ascents is equal to the number of inversion sequences with distinct values.
This conjecture predicts an equidistribution between ascents in Schröder paths and the number of distinct values in 021-avoiding inversion sequences. The source says that the correspondence is suggested by computations and that the previously constructed bijections do not establish it; no resolution is provided.
